Hodnotenie:
Táto kniha je vysoko cenená ako komplexný a dobre napísaný zdroj informácií pre nových aj skúsených vývojárov Apache Camel. Ponúka jasné príklady, praktické pokyny a podrobné pokrytie základných konceptov, vďaka čomu je povinnou literatúrou pre každého, kto sa podieľa na projektoch Camel. Niektorí recenzenti však upozornili na nedostatok praktických rád pre tých, ktorí nie sú dobre zbehlí v programovaní, ako aj na obavy týkajúce sa kvality väzby a ceny knihy.
Výhody:⬤ Dobre napísaná, ľahko čitateľná
⬤ komplexné pokrytie problematiky Camel
⬤ skvelé príklady a vzorový kód
⬤ vhodná pre začiatočníkov aj skúsených vývojárov
⬤ definitívny zdroj informácií, ktorého autorom je vedúci vývojár
⬤ užitočná podpora komunity
⬤ aktualizovaný obsah v najnovšom vydaní.
⬤ Nie veľmi užitočné pre tých, ktorí nemajú skúsenosti s Mavenom alebo programovaním
⬤ minimálne pokrytie SOAP
⬤ veľký dôraz na kód namiesto nekódovej konfigurácie
⬤ niektoré sťažnosti na kvalitu väzieb a vnímanú vysokú cenu.
(na základe 24 čitateľských recenzií)
Camel in Action
Zhrnutie
Camel in Action, Second Edition je najkomplexnejšia kniha o Camel na trhu. Táto kniha, napísaná hlavnými vývojármi Camel a autormi vysoko uznávaného prvého vydania, zhromažďuje ich skúsenosti a praktické poznatky, aby ste mohli riešiť integračné úlohy ako profesionál.
Predslovy napísali James Strachan a Dr. Mark Little.
Zakúpenie tlačenej knihy zahŕňa bezplatnú elektronickú knihu vo formátoch PDF, Kindle a ePub od Manning Publications.
O technológii
Apache Camel je framework v jazyku Java, ktorý implementuje vzory podnikovej integrácie (EIP) a dodáva sa s viac ako 200 adaptérmi na systémy tretích strán. Stručný DSL vám umožňuje zabudovať integračnú logiku do aplikácie len pomocou niekoľkých riadkov jazyka Java alebo XML. Používaním Camel môžete využívať testovanie a skúsenosti veľkej a živej komunity open source.
O knihe
Camel in Action, Second Edition je definitívny sprievodca systémom Camel. Začína základnými pojmami, ako je odosielanie, prijímanie, smerovanie a transformácia údajov. Potom sa podrobne venuje mnohým témam, napríklad ako vyvíjať, ladiť, testovať, riešiť chyby, zabezpečovať, škálovať, vytvárať klastre, nasadzovať a monitorovať aplikácie Camel. V knihe sa tiež rozoberá, ako prevádzkovať Camel s mikroslužbami, reaktívnymi systémami, kontajnermi a v cloude.
Čo je vnútri
⬤ Pokrytie všetkých relevantných EIP.
⬤ Mikroslužby Camel so Spring Boot.
⬤ Camel na Dockeri a Kubernete.
⬤ Ošetrovanie chýb, testovanie, bezpečnosť, clustering, monitorovanie a nasadenie.
⬤ Stovky príkladov v jazyku Java a XML.
O čitateľovi
Čitatelia by mali poznať jazyk Java. Táto kniha je prístupná pre začiatočníkov a neoceniteľná pre odborníkov.
O autorovi
Claus Ibsen je starší hlavný inžinier pracujúci pre spoločnosť Red Hat, ktorý sa špecializuje na cloud a integráciu. Posledných deväť rokov pracoval na projekte Apache Camel, kde ho vedie. Claus žije v Dánsku.
Jonathan Anstey je manažér inžinierstva v spoločnosti Red Hat a hlavný prispievateľ do projektu Camel. Žije v Newfoundlande v Kanade.
Obsah
Časť 1 - Prvé kroky.
⬤ Zoznámenie sa s Camel.
⬤ Smerovanie pomocou Camel.
Časť 2 - Jadro Camel.
⬤ Transformovanie údajov pomocou Camel.
⬤ Používanie fazule s Camel.
⬤ Podnikové integračné vzory.
⬤ Používanie komponentov.
Časť 3 - Vývoj a testovanie.
⬤ Mikroslužby.
⬤ Vývoj projektov Camel.
⬤ Testovanie.
⬤ Vebové služby typu REST.
Časť 4 - Ako ďalej s Camel.
⬤ Ošetrovanie chýb.
⬤ Transakcie a idempotencia.
⬤ Paralelné spracovanie.
⬤ Zabezpečenie Camel.
Časť 5 - Spustenie a správa Camel.
⬤ Spustenie a nasadenie Camel.
⬤ Správa a monitorovanie.
Časť 6 - Vo voľnej prírode.
⬤ Klastrovanie.
⬤ Mikroslužby s Dockerom a Kubernetes.
⬤ Prístroje Camel.
Bonusové online kapitoly.
K dispozícii na adrese https: //www.manning.com/books/camel-in-action-second-edition a v elektronických verziách tejto knihy:
⬤ Reaktívne Camel.
⬤ Camel a internet vecí od Henryka Konseka.
© Book1 Group - všetky práva vyhradené.
Obsah tejto stránky nesmie byť kopírovaný ani použitý čiastočne alebo v celku bez písomného súhlasu vlastníka.
Posledná úprava: 2024.11.13 22:11 (GMT)